Welcome to The Hay Shed! We have been producing the greenest grass for decades, which has been perfectly prepared for your pets. We grow, mow, dry and pack our premium hay, all from our family farm based in Northumberland. Great care is taken at every stage to ensure unbeatable quality and nutrient-dense hay for your small pets.
